parser grammar SpelParser;

options {
tokenVocab = SpelLexer;
}
script
: spelExpr EOF
;
spelExpr
: (PLUS | MINUS | NOT | INC | DEC) spelExpr // ~unaryspelExpr
| spelExpr (INC | DEC) // ~incspelExpr
| spelExpr POWER spelExpr // ~powerExpr
| spelExpr (STAR | DIV | MOD) spelExpr // ~productspelExpr
| spelExpr (PLUS | MINUS) spelExpr // ~sumspelExpr
| spelExpr (GT | LT | LE | GE | EQ | NE | GT_KEYWORD | LT_KEYWORD | LE_KEYWORD | GE_KEYWORD | EQ_KEYWORD | NE_KEYWORD) spelExpr // ~relationalspelExpr
| spelExpr (AND | SYMBOLIC_AND) spelExpr // ~logicalAndspelExpr
| spelExpr (OR | SYMBOLIC_OR) spelExpr // ~logicalOrspelExpr
| spelExpr MATCHES spelExpr // ~regexExpr
// spelExpr
| spelExpr ASSIGN spelExpr
| spelExpr ELVIS spelExpr
| spelExpr QMARK spelExpr COLON spelExpr
// primaryspelExpr
| startNode node*
;
node
: dottedNode
| nonDottedNode
;
nonDottedNode
: (LSQUARE spelExpr RSQUARE)
| inputParameter
| propertyPlaceHolder
;
dottedNode
: (DOT | SAFE_NAVI) methodOrProperty
| functionOrVar
| projection
| selection
;
functionOrVar
: HASH IDENTIFIER
| HASH IDENTIFIER methodArgs
;
methodArgs
: LPAREN args RPAREN
;
args
: spelExpr? (COMMA spelExpr)*
;
methodOrProperty
: IDENTIFIER
| IDENTIFIER methodArgs
;
projection
: PROJECT spelExpr RSQUARE
;
selection
: (SELECT | SELECT_FIRST | SELECT_LAST) spelExpr RSQUARE
;
startNode
: literal
| parenspelExpr
| typeReference
| nullReference
| constructorReference
| methodOrProperty
| functionOrVar
| beanReference
| projection
| selection
| inlineListOrMap
| inputParameter
| propertyPlaceHolder
;
literal
: numericLiteral
| STRING_LITERAL
| TRUE
| FALSE
;
numericLiteral
: INTEGER_LITERAL
| REAL_LITERAL
;
parenspelExpr
: LPAREN spelExpr RPAREN
;
typeReference
: T LPAREN possiblyQualifiedId (LSQUARE RSQUARE)* RPAREN
;
possiblyQualifiedId
: IDENTIFIER (DOT IDENTIFIER)*
;
nullReference
: NULL
;
constructorReference
: NEW possiblyQualifiedId (LSQUARE spelExpr? RSQUARE)+ inlineListOrMap?
| NEW possiblyQualifiedId constructorArgs
;
constructorArgs
: LPAREN args RPAREN
;
inlineListOrMap
: LCURLY RCURLY
| LCURLY COLON RCURLY
| LCURLY listBindings RCURLY
| LCURLY mapBindings RCURLY
;
listBindings
: bindings+=listBinding (COMMA bindings+=listBinding)*
;
listBinding
: spelExpr
;
mapBindings
: bindings+=mapBinding (COMMA bindings+=mapBinding)*
;
mapBinding
: key=spelExpr COLON value=spelExpr
;
beanReference
: (BEAN_REF | FACTORY_BEAN_REF) (IDENTIFIER | STRING_LITERAL)
;
inputParameter
: (LSQUARE INTEGER_LITERAL RSQUARE)
;
propertyPlaceHolder
: PROPERTY_PLACE_HOLDER
;
